Donations – St. Louis Children’s Hospital, Cardinal Glennon Children’s Hospital, and Mercy Children’s Hospital

As part of our continuing mission to donate new LEGO sets to St. Louis-area children’s hospitals, we delivered approximately $1000-worth of sets each to St. Louis Children’s Hospital, Cardinal Glennon Children’s Hospital, and Mercy Hospital St. Louis on Thursday, November 20th. Donation – Yeatman-Liddell Middle School

On May 16, 2025, the St. Louis area was hit by a large, destructive tornado. A number of schools were significantly damaged by the storm, impacting their ability to finish the year and even open in the Fall. GtwLUG earmarked part of our charity funds this year to supporting one of the schools affected, and on Wednesday, October 29th two of our club members were able to drop off our donation of 12 LEGO Education BricQ Motion Prime kits to Dr. Christopher Crumble, the principal of Yeatman-Liddell College Preparatory Middle School, which is currently operating out of another school building while the school is being rebuilt. Bricks for Water 2026

Gateway LUG is proud to be invited back to a great charity event.  One of our members and his wife are once again putting on a show to raise money to support clean water and sanitation efforts in the developing world, through the charity World Vision International.  This is a one-day LEGO event in Edwardsville, IL with all proceeds going to the charitable donation (they are covering overhead expenses themselves).  More information can be found on the Bricks for Water Facebook page.
